Meet Opal

Are you looking for the perfect cat? Of course you are! Please let A.R.F. introduce you to Opal! Opal was sent to the shelter after her previous family lost everything in a house fire. The family was devastated to lose her, but had no other options. After just two days in the shelter environment, she gave birth to 7 kittens. She was a wonderful mom, raising all 7 babies in the shelter. Eventually, all of her kittens found their forever homes, and Opal waited in an animal control shelter downstate for 6 months without any interest before being rescued by A.R.F.

This sweet girl is more than ready to find her forever home. She is so sweet, and loves to cuddle and sit in your lap, but is also playful (this is why she's the perfect cat!) She will twirl around your legs for attention, loves to play with her wand toys, and volunteers report that she loves to play "soccer" with bouncy ball toys. She LOVES cat trees and couches, and will sit and watch birds and the outside worlds for hours. Come evening, though, she's ready to cuddle with you and watch TV! Opal would definitely be happiest as the only cat in the house - she loves having all of the attention! Opal really just wants to be that special someone to her special someone! All pets adopted from A.R.F.-Animal Rescue Foundation include the following as part of their adoption fee:

  • Spay/neuter or a certificate for a low-cost spay/neuter when medically recommended
  • Microchip and registration, a permanent identification to reunite lost pets with their owners
  • Initial de-worming and flea and tick treatment
  • Age-appropriate testing for heartworm/FIV-FELV
  • Age-appropriate vaccines
  • Pre-adoption medical exam
  • A certificate for a free healthy pet exam at one of A.R.F.’s participating veterinarians within 7 days of adoption
  • Offer for a no-risk 30 day free trial with Trupanion pet medical insurance
